Introdução à programação com Python+Processing

De Garoa Hacker Clube
Revisão de 00h04min de 5 de abril de 2016 por Villares (discussão | contribs)
Ir para navegação Ir para pesquisar
Olha o mouse.gif
Olha o mouse.png

Oficina Py.Processing 100 noção

Uma oficina rápida (2h) que oferece uma experiência de programação para pessoas totalmente leigas usando Processing Python Mode

Hein?

A ideia é desmistificar e abrir o apetite para o uso da programação por 'não programadores', pessoas cuja atividade profissional principal não é a programação.

Usos de Processing e Python que atraem 'não programadores':

  • Visualização de dados;
  • Arte computacional;
  • Programação criativa;
  • Design gerativo;
  • 'Scrapping' de dados públicos;
  • Automação de tarefas repetitivas.

Próximas edições na agenda! Venha! Traga o seu computador!

Não tem inscrição!
Se possível baixe antes o Processing em http://processing.org/download

sábado 09/04/2016 17h00

terça 12/04/2016 19h30

O que é Processing?

Processing é uma plataforma livre/aberta de programação criada em 2001 por Casey Reas e Ben Fry, largamente utilizada por artistas e para o ensino de programação num contexto visual. O Processing IDE (da sigla em inglês para ambiente integrado de desenvolvimento – simplificando, um editor de texto para código) pode ser baixado em https://www.processing.org (curiosamente ele deu origem ao IDE do Arduino).

A versão 'standard' do Processing é uma linguagem baseada em Java, mas hoje existem outros projetos da Fundação Processing como P5*JS (baseado em JavaScript). Durante algum tempo foi mantido o Processing Modo Python, baseado em Jython 2.7, que não tem mais um mantenedor nem atualizações.

Outras ferramentas de programação incorporaram o vocabulário e/ou a infraestrutura gráfica do Processing como por exemplo py5 (https://py5coding.org) uma biblioteca/framework para programação criativa em Python 3.

Referências

Atividades relacionadas

Noite de Processing